Offset printing replicates photorealistic designs with excellent clarity. This option can accommodate smaller font sizes and intricate photos and designs. At Givr, this option is only available for folding carton structures and litho label item. Offset accommodate special embellishments like UV Spot Gloss, foil/metallic inks, and embossing/debossing. Offset printing uses metallic print print plates that overlay each other to create high quality, photorealistic results. While offset printing requires more print plates for each design, the cost per plate is typically lower that Flexo print plates. Minimum Order Quantities (MOQ) apply for offset printing. Typically the MOQ for offset is 5,000 pieces.
